A leading media agency in Greater London is seeking an experienced Account Director to join their client services team. The ideal candidate will have over 6 years of media agency experience, capable of managing key accounts and leading high-performance teams.
Responsibilities include:
- Developing client-driven media strategies
- Ensuring high-quality deliverables
This role offers competitive compensation and a dynamic workplace culture focused on inclusivity and growth.
